More than 100 motorbikes and vehicles joined the funeral procession of a father-of-two who died in a collision on the outskirts of Littleport.   

Chelsie Roberts has publicly thanked everyone who made her husband Bradley’s send-off a day to remember.   

She said: “I’m so grateful to our wonderful community, from those who accompanied us on Brad’s final journey to the neighbours who lined the streets to wish him farewell.   

“The procession was such a sight to behold.   

“I was riding pillion behind the motorbike hearse carrying Brad and when I looked back, there were gleaming bikes for as far as I could see. The sound was also amazing.

Brad, 30, popped out to buy a new car on January 31 when he died at the scene of a collision on the A1101 Mildenhall Road.     

He was riding his purple Kawasaki motorbike when it was involved in a collision with a Nissan Qashqai at the Mile End Road junction.
